About Suzanne Phillips
Suzanne Phillips is a scholar working on Clinical Psychology, General Health Professions, Oncology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, having authored 41 papers that have together received 688 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include CAR-T cell therapy research (6 papers), Brain Metastases and Treatment (4 papers), Diabetes Treatment and Management (4 papers), Cancer Immunotherapy and Biomarkers (4 papers), Maternal Mental Health During Pregnancy and Postpartum (3 papers), Child and Adolescent Psychosocial and Emotional Development (3 papers), Metabolism, Diabetes, and Cancer (2 papers) and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Research and Theory (6 citations), Organizational Behavior and Human Resource Management (80 citations), General Decision Sciences (11 citations), Rehabilitation (31 citations) and Psychiatry and Mental health (66 citations). Suzanne Phillips has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Dean B. McFarlin, Robert W. Rice, Anna Maria Simone, Alan Tennant, Haim Ring, Gunnar Grimby, Črt Marinček, Anita Slade, Massimo Penta and Åsa Lundgren‐Nilsson.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, Blood, Journal of Applied Psychology, Health Psychology and Sexual Abuse.
